前端三剑客

后端backend

从头开始:1.网络编程+HTTP实现

                   Web服务器(HTTP服务器) —— Tomcat

编程方程反转了,不再写main方法了(不是以我们为主)

我们的代码会被Tomcat加载来使用,意味着,我们需要遵守很多规则。

Servlet(早期,经典)

SpringWeb(使用较多)


Web开发的内容:

浏览器进程     解析(HTML骨架+CSS样式+JS灵魂)现在是让浏览器进程打开文件

                       以后 浏览器的进程 通过HTTP协议网络和服务器进程进行交互

为啥要找个服务器?

CSS和HTML这些资源并不是存在于每一个人的电脑上,所以我们需要打开百度的资源。让浏览器先与服务器进程进行通信,让服务器帮我们交互

资源resources     HTML文件 /CSS文件/图片资源

1.前端三剑客(HTML/css/JavaScript)      可以独立完成一个功能简单基本无样式的网页

用来结构化数据

2.HTTP协议(HTTPS协议)

3.基于Servlet的资源开发

4.环境搭建、软件使用


HTML

1.输出性标签

标题:

...

段落:

图片:   这是单标签  src/height/width

超链接: herf/target

2.表格系列

列表:

    • 3.输入型元素

      用于浏览器收集用户填写的信息,提交给服务器

      1.表单标签

      表单

         框出一块区域,作为整体提交到服务器

      2.标签

       type:text          普通的文本框(浏览器有回显)

      type:password  密码(浏览器关闭回显***)

      type: radio         单选框的其中一个选项

      type: checkbox  复选框的一个选项

      type: button        等同于